Once everyone was filled up, it was time to head to the rink!  Fans could not have asked for a better game between the two storied franchises. After 60 minutes of back and forth hockey, the game went into overtime with a score of 3-3. After successfully killing off a penalty in the extra frame, John Tavares potted the winner by beating Carey Price with a back-hand beauty after taking a slick feed from Mitch Marner, giving the Maple Leafs the 3-2 overtime win.
